English actress, singer, dancer and presenter

Denise Van Outen is an English actress, singer, dancer, and presenter. She commenced her television career with roles in diverse British dramas, including Kappatoo and The Bill. She co-presented The Big Breakfast with Johnny Vaughan from 1997 to 2001 and later Johnny & Denise: Passport to Paradise with him in 2004. Van Outen has also appeared in films such as Tube Tales in 1999 alongside Rachel Weisz and Gloves Off in 2017. She has released singles including That's What Friends Are For with Duncan James, On My Own, and From New York To L.A.
